migration/multifd: Simplify locking in sender thread

The sender thread will yield the p->mutex before IO starts, trying to not
block the requester thread.  This may be unnecessary lock optimizations,
because the requester can already read pending_job safely even without the
lock, because the requester is currently the only one who can assign a
task.

Drop that lock complication on both sides:

  (1) in the sender thread, always take the mutex until job done
  (2) in the requester thread, check pending_job clear lockless
